Output 8d1e59accd7c8b4862921c0fd434ffe8f57504a430087d8ee8c45eccb7d5b09f:1

value
620200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abcb8f9600ef79b46e7addf5e2c88001025ce9f OP_EQUAL
address
3MdbK32gQmeLJ6DoPx37ttRDRkN1yTks6L
transaction
8d1e59accd7c8b4862921c0fd434ffe8f57504a430087d8ee8c45eccb7d5b09f
confirmations
283119
spent
true